Why can paddy not be grown in winter season?

Answer:
During winter large amount of water is not available. Hence due to unavailability of sufficient water and unfavourable climatic conditions paddy should not be grown in the winter season. Paddy is a kharif crop which is sown in rainy season. It requires lots of water for its growth.
